Being raped by a person you knew and trusted would be the pits. But, if you were to kill him then he wins. Then he hurts you again. Rape is not about sex. It is about power and control. If you were to kill him he would still have the power and control. You must be strong and brave. Strong enough to go to the police, strong enough to face the tests necessary to prove the rape, and brave enough to testify against him in court. Facing him with what he did to you will take the power and control away from him and give them to you. When he goes to prison you become the winner. Be sure to get your friend into some counseling to help her become the real winner in this situation.

Some people remain silent about what happened to them. Some people kill or find some other way to wreak havoc on the criminal's life. Both are WRONG because there is no justice in either.
She needs to go to the hospital, if it's not too late for a rape kit, and to the police. ASAP. Get her to see a counselor too. Try a women's crisis center.
